Compare all specifications:
1971 Abarth A 112 | 1995 Nissan Presea | |
Make | Abarth | Nissan |
Model | A 112 | Presea |
Year Released | 1971 | 1995 |
Engine Size | 965 cc | 1497 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 0 HP | 104 HP |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Vehicle Weight | 685 kg | 1030 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3240 mm | 4490 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1490 mm | 1700 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1300 mm | 1330 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2040 mm | 2590 mm |
